NBC News has created a widget that will tell you whether IBM used photos from your Flickr account to train facial recognition artificial intelligence.
The interactive feature is part of a deep dive the network did on the widespread use of publicly available images to train algorithms without their subjects’ consent, a common practice in the artificial intelligence community with questionable privacy implications.
